Why is Federer not playing Roland Garros?

“After discussions with my team, I’ve decided I will need to pull out of Roland Garros today,” Federer wrote on Twitter. “After two knee surgeries and over a year of rehabilitation, it’s important that I listen to my body and make sure I don’t push myself too quickly on my road to recovery.

Why is Djokovic match suspended on Roland Garros?

Novak Djokovic’s French Open quarter-final against Matteo Berrettini was briefly suspended on Wednesday after spectators protested against an 11pm coronavirus curfew. Djokovic was up 2-1 in sets and leading 3-2 when play was halted.

Is Roland Garros ahead 2021?

The organisers of Roland Garros have taken the decision to postpone the season’s second Grand Slam by a week in the hope of allowing fans to be in attendance for the event in Paris. Roland Garros will now be held from 30 May to 13 June with the qualifying rounds taking place the week before.
